It plays OK in VLC.
It seems it is a 48kHz 32bit floating-point sample stream which is a bit
unusual.
It should be in ADTS format ( https://wiki.multimedia.cx/index.php/ADTS
) and so the format would be endcoded in the first few bytes - the
following are from the stream
Code:
If I change the URL and request .mp3 then it works
https://chai5she.cdn.dvmr.fr/mouvrapfr-hifi.mp3
